HELP ME, need moorage in SoCal

I am looking at a good deal for a 1976 Ericson 36c. My problem is the seller has to move the boat and will not accept an offer without proof that I have a wet slip or a mooring to move the boat to after the close.

I found a slip at Kings Harbor for $987/month, not an option. Can anyone suggest a slip or mooring field that is reasonably priced and has openings. I can't believe I am the only newby who has or is currently going through this.

If you're open for another 80 miles south of San Diego, I'm paying about $450/mo at Cruiseport marina in Ensenada. Walking distance to decent restaurants. Safe and secure. Commute over border sucks.

Check in all the marinas in Channel Islands. They had a lot of slips damaged by previous storms but I do know some 30 foot slips have opened up at Peninsula yacht marina. They had been clearing out some boats, they may have a 35 foot side tie but I am not sure. Check at Anacapa marina too. Good luck!

They compile a list of ALL slips every year, and there are additional ads in their "digital" edition that comes out every 2 weeks. Best bet right now probably San Pedro/LA or Chula Vista in San Diego.
